    When I worked offshore and we would do easy and quick, we had a similar recipe…
    Large can of pie filling of choice.
    Box of cake mix of choice.
    Stick of butter.
    Pour filling in casserole dish, pour cake mix over, cut stick of butter into slices and place over cake mix, covering top (spaced). Bake… you’ll know when it’s done as it will have developed a browned crust. Enjoy!

    We call it a dump cake when I make it for our camping. I usually add 7up/Sprite to it for more moisture. Comes out really well.
